  • Hi John Greeley,

    Please watch the following demonstration video available from our Carveco Training portal: Saving Your Toolpaths

    If you're working in imperial units and using:

    • Candle as your machine controller, when saving your calculated toolpaths from Carveco Maker, select the Sainsmart 3018 PROver (inch) (*.tap) post processor option from the Save Toolpaths dialog's Machine file format list.
    • Universal Gcode Sender as your machine controller, when saving your calculated toolpaths from Carveco Maker, select the UGS GRBL (inch) (*.gcode) post processor option from the Save Toolpaths dialog's Machine file format list.
